Deletion of murine <i>Rhoh</i> leads to de-repression of <i>Bcl-6</i> via decreased KAISO levels and accelerates a malignancy phenotype in a murine model of lymphoma
Published 2022“…Mechanistically, we demonstrated that deletion of Rhoh in these murine lymphoma cells was associated with decreased levels of the RhoH binding partner KAISO, a dual-specific Zinc finger transcription factor, de-repression of KAISO target Bcl-6, and downregulation of the BCL-6 target Blimp-1. …”

6:2 Chlorinated Polyfluoroalkyl Ether Sulfonate (F-53B) Induces Aging and Parkinson’s Disease-like Disorders in <i>C. elegans</i> at Low Concentrations
Published 2025“…F-53B also induced Parkinson’s disease (PD)-like disorders including dyskinesia (incidence: 22.8–27.9%), dopaminergic neuronal damage (neuritic blebbings and broken neurites) and decreased dopamine levels (15.2–28.1%), increased abundance (1.3–1.4 fold) and aggregation of α-synuclein. …”
